a plumber uses 200 ft of tubing to make 50 sections of the same size. At this rate, how many feet of tubing is needed to make 1 section?

Respuesta :

kp51962
kp51962 kp51962
  • 03-11-2021

Answer:

4 ft

Step-by-step explanation:

You need to divide that 200 ft among those 50 sections to get what amount of feet goes into each section.
